Wrap the USB in electrical tape. Probably over-kill, but I did not want the stuffing touching the electronics. Also, this thumb drive had a write-protection switch that I did not want locked on accident.

Place the USB in position
Pull small quantities of batting or stuffing material and stuff into the tube, both on top of and below the USB circuit board.
Continue stuffing up to the end of the tube. I used the blunt end of a Bic pen to tamp the stuffing all the way to the deepest part of the tube.

Remember to use a little less at the end so it can taper to a close. Judge for yourself how much stuffing you need to use.
